Gameplay

'Hot Wheels Unleashed' is essentially a glorious love letter to both the childhood of racing game enthusiasts and adults who feel the need for speed without the associated insurance, gas, and existential crises. The game is all about going fast, jumping high, and using your controller to catch your friends off-guard with some epic maneuvers (without causing permanent damage, hopefully). Players take control of iconic Hot Wheels vehicles, speeding through a variety of miniature tracks that are vividly set in everyday environments-like your garage, kitchen, and even under your mom's bed (just be careful of the dust bunnies!). With the ability to customize over 66 different cars, you can make a futuristic supercar or a retro hot rod that looks like it was pulled straight from a time capsule from the 70s. Want to know what's even more exciting? Players can partake in a career mode, local split-screen, and online multiplayer races while simultaneously painting everyone's dream car and racing against the clock in time trial modes. Throw in a track editor that should make your inner architect squeal with glee, and you're set for one exhilarating joyride.

Graphics

Visually, 'Hot Wheels Unleashed' is about as colorful as a box of crayons after a toddler's art class. Using Unreal Engine 4, the graphics are sharp, vibrant, and entirely capable of making you believe that your childhood imagination has come to life. The game's tracks sparkle like they just had a spa day, with tracks that dip, dive, and loop d-loop with style that would make a rollercoaster blush. Each car model is painstakingly designed to mimic its physical counterpart; it's like a museum exhibit of toy cars, but you can actually and actively race them, smashing into your friend's Ka-Chow! Lightning McQueen replica while yelling, 'I AM SPEED!' at the top of your lungs.
